The EX-28B is designed with the following specifications: - Operating Voltage: 5V - 15V - Gain Bandwidth Product: 100 MHz - Input Bias Current: 10nA - Input Offset Voltage: 2mV - Slew Rate: 5V/µs - Operating Temperature: -40°C to 85°C
The EX-28B has a standard 8-pin Dual Inline Package (DIP) configuration: 1. Input 2. Non-Inverting Input 3. Inverting Input 4. V- 5. Offset Null 6. Output 7. V+ 8. NC (No Connection)
The EX-28B operates based on the principles of operational amplifiers, utilizing feedback to achieve desired signal processing and amplification. By adjusting the input and feedback configurations, the device can be tailored to specific application requirements.
The EX-28B finds extensive use in the following application fields: - Audio Amplification: Used in audio equipment such as preamplifiers and equalizers. - Instrumentation: Employed in measurement and control systems for signal conditioning. - Communication Systems: Integrated into RF (Radio Frequency) circuits for signal processing.
Several alternative models to the EX-28B include: - LM741: A widely used general-purpose operational amplifier. - AD827: Precision operational amplifier with low noise and high bandwidth. - TL072: Dual operational amplifier with low noise and high slew rate.
